YEAR 3-6 ROUNDERS FESTIVAL

This fun event is due to take place at Upton on Wednesday 3rd July, 4-5.30pm. It is a friendly festival and every school will play 3 matches with medals for all at the end. There is a maximum of 11 players and a minimum of 7 per team. As we play with tennis balls the age range can be any combination of boys and girls from Year 3 to Year 6. Please read the attached rules carefully, as schools often have their own slight variations. The rules are those according to the NRA, with the only exception being that games are timed and if a player is out they can carry on batting with a one rounder penalty for each dismissal. This is designed to increase participation and ensure that all games finish at the same time.

YEARS 5/6 SUPER 8s KWIK CRICKET

To finish the Passport year we always have 2 Kwik Cricket Festivals arranged, at Margate CC on Friday 5th July and at Broadstairs CC on Friday 12th July, both 4-5.20pm. This is an opportunity for schools to play a couple of friendly matches. There are no medals or trophies - it is just turn up, play and have fun. Kwik cricket rules apply EXCEPT that players must all face 6 balls when batting and underarm bowling is permitted throughout (see attached rules).
